Dress for the Job You Want

When it comes to success in the workplace, your appearance can play a crucial role. Dressing in a way that is appropriate for your job and aligns with the company’s culture and values can help you make a positive impression. It shows that you are professional, confident, and take your work seriously.

One popular saying is “dress for the job you want, not the job you have.” This means that you should dress in a way that reflects the level of responsibility and position you aspire to achieve. Even if you are not yet in your desired role, dressing the part can help you stand out and be seen as someone who is ready to take on more responsibilities.

However, it is important to note that dressing for the job you want doesn’t mean you have to copy the exact outfit of someone in that position. It’s about understanding the dress code and expectations of your industry and company, and then adding your own personal style and flair to it.

Here are a few tips to keep in mind when it comes to dressing for the job you want:

  1. Research the company’s dress code: Every company has its own dress code policy. Make sure you understand what is considered appropriate and what is not. Some companies may require business formal attire, while others may have a more casual dress code. Dressing in a way that aligns with the company’s dress code will show that you respect and understand its culture.
  2. Observe others in higher positions: Take a look at how people in higher positions dress. This can give you a sense of what is considered appropriate for the job you want. Pay attention to the way they style their outfits, the colors they choose, and the overall image they project. Use this as inspiration to create your own professional and polished look.
  3. Invest in high-quality clothing: Spending a little more on high-quality clothing can make a big difference in your appearance. Well-fitted clothes made from good fabrics will not only look better but also make you feel more confident. Investing in a few staple pieces that can be mixed and matched will ensure that you always have something appropriate to wear.
  4. Pay attention to grooming: Dressing for success is not just about the clothes you wear. Personal grooming is equally important. Make sure your hair is well-styled, your nails are neat, and your overall hygiene is on point. Taking care of these details will help you look polished and put together.

Remember, dressing for the job you want is not about wearing expensive designer clothing or following the latest fashion trends. It’s about showing that you have the professionalism, confidence, and attention to detail that will help you succeed in your desired role. So, next time you open your closet in the morning, think about what your outfit says about your aspirations and dress accordingly.

Use Quotes to Find Inspiration

Quotes have the power to inspire and motivate us to achieve great things. When it comes to dressing for success, finding the right inspiration can make all the difference. Here are some quotes that can help you find the motivation you need to dress for success:

“Dress shabbily and they remember the dress; dress impeccably and they remember the woman.” – Coco Chanel

Coco Chanel, a fashion icon, believed that dressing impeccably was a way to make a lasting impression. This quote reminds us that our appearance can have a significant impact on how others perceive us.

“You can have anything you want in life if you dress for it.” – Edith Head

Edith Head, a renowned costume designer, believed that dressing for success could help us achieve our goals. This quote encourages us to dress the part and believe in our own potential.

“Clothes mean nothing until someone lives in them.” – Marc Jacobs

Marc Jacobs, a famous fashion designer, emphasized the importance of wearing clothes that reflect our personality. This quote reminds us that our clothing should make us feel comfortable and confident.

“The way we dress affects the way we think, the way we feel, the way we act, and the way others react to us.” – Judith Rasband

Judith Rasband, a fashion consultant, highlighted the influence of clothing on our mindset and behavior. This quote encourages us to consider how dressing for success can have a positive impact on various aspects of our lives.

Remember, finding the right inspiration is key to dressing for success. Use these quotes to fuel your motivation and approach each day with confidence.
